Elite Dock USB-C (T3V74AA)
Microsoft Windows 10 (64-bit)

I just purchased an Elite Dock USB-C (T3V74AA) to use with my EliteBook 840 G3.  I have connected the Elite Dock to its power source and plugged it in.  The power LED glows on and off indicating it is in standby mode.

 

When I connect the Elite Dock to the USB-C port on the laptop nothing happens.

It isn't detected in Device Manager, and the power LED continues to indicate that it is in stand-by mode.

 

None of the devices that I plug into the dock are recognized either.

 

Any sugguestions?

 

Thank you,

Jason

I have the same problem with a G4.  I was then told that the USB-C dock does not work with that model on the USB-C port!!  Have you any updates?

HP Recommended

Yes, I was told the same thing.  the Elite Dock USB-C is not compatable with the EliteBook.
